Job Description

Job Purpose: The Human Resources Manager is responsible for the effective and efficient running of the human resource (HR) function. He/She applies his business and financial knowledge of the Group and advises Management on HR matters and the relevant impact to the organisation. He drives the culture of the organisation by championing organisational values and cultivating the desired culture of the organisation with other senior Managers and stakeholders. He has a sound understanding of the external environment impacting the organisation and provides strategic foresight and HR insights to offer innovative solutions in solving organisational issues.The Human Resources Manager adopts a global, forward-thinking perspective and effectively integrates various considerations to arrive at well-rationalised decisions. He is an influential and inspiring leader who effectively builds relationships and engages with various stakeholders within and beyond the organisation.Apply Business and Financial Acumen

  • Formulate and shape the organisation's business strategy and enterprise risk management with senior business leaders and stakeholders by giving inputs related to business and people agenda.
  • Deliver credible and persuasive presentations to senior business leaders and stakeholders and display deep understanding of the business and industry.
  • Display professional maturity and executive presence in dealing with contentious or sensitive topics during discussion with senior business leaders and stakeholders.
  • Advise senior business leaders and stakeholders on the design of the organisation structure to enable business strategy and support the business objectives aligning to the organisation's vision, mission and goals.
  • Identify and assess an organisation's current and future core capabilities required to deliver against business strategy in a competitive operating environment and changing business landscape and economic conditions.
Steer Organisational Culture and Change
  • Champion organisational values and cultivate desired culture with other senior business leaders and stakeholders.
  • Identify strategies for managing and resolving organisational challenges in the areas of ethics, culture and performance.
  • Provide clarity to the expected conduct and behaviours of all employees by ensuring behaviours are consistent with the values of the organisation.
  • Promote changes to the existing operating environment that positively impacts working relations and partnerships with internal and external stakeholders.
  • Lead HR transformation programmes in pursuit of optimised workforce, HR technology and operational excellence in the delivery of HR services.
Deliver Strategic Insights and Foresights
  • Evaluate the implications of the external environment (political, regulatory, economic, social, technological, legal) on the industry, organization, and people, and respond to challenges in an agile manner.
  • Scan the current, regional, and international business landscape to identify emerging trends and develop long-term strategies, provide insightful perspectives and foresights so as to always take pre-emptive action to capitalise on new opportunities or navigate people-related risk and regulatory complexities.
  • Influence best practices by leveraging lessons learned from HR community and marketplace trends, setting the trend and innovating HR solutions to position the organisation as an employer of choice.
Drive HR Business Partnering
  • Define the impact of current marketplace dynamics and current and future industry trends on the organisation's HR strategy and initiatives prior to implementation.
  • Position the HR function as a business partner with other business leaders by forging closer relationships and working collaboratively with them to add value to business and employee agenda.
  • Apply a value-based or principle-based approach to dealing with dilemmas or paradoxes and being the "conscience" of the organisation in such situations.
  • Advocate the people agenda in all matters to cultivate a culture where employees in the organisation are valued and engaged.
